
RF BJT NPN transistor for high-frequency applications, operating up to 1GHz. Features a 17V collector-emitter voltage, 1.2A max collector current, and 100 minimum hFE. This surface mount component is housed in an 8-pin SOIC package, offering a power dissipation of 6.4W and a gain of 11.6dB. Designed for operation between 3V and 3.6V supply voltage, with a temperature range of -40°C to 85°C.
